Minimum Qualifications
  • High school diploma or GED equivalent.
  • 5+ years of experience developing the required documents for the A&A package (e.g., SSP, CP, and SAR), including oversight and development of POA&M's, and performing all continuous monitoring functions with the most recent experience occurring in the last three years.
  • 5+ years of experience implementing NIST 800-53A security controls for federal agencies.
  • 1+ years of experience in data structures, data mining, and business intelligence, with the ability to correlate data across multiple disparate sources, linking common data elements, and constructing informative visualizations.
  • Current CISSP certification. All professional certifications must include a certification number (Ex: CISSP certification number, GIAC analyst number, etc.).
  • Background check required.
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ities
  • Experience in applying risk management techniques to develop and complete risk assessments based on NIST standards to ensure system design and implementation sufficiently addresses or mitigates IA risk.
